SPECIAL FEATURES

1. Ample Power and Lower Distortion

With a generous minimum rms output power of
25 Watts per channel, both channels driven, into
8~ohm speakers, and no more than 0.05%
distortion, CA-44 performance is exceptional.
And the same low distortion is preserved right
down to 250 mW, a tremendous power-distortion
range.

2. Full-Range Power Output Meters

The separate meters for L and R-hand channels
cover the whole range from 0.01 Watt to 50 Watts
in one unswitched range, a valuable feature that
lets you know how much power your speakers are
handling.

3. Special Low Distortion Low Noise Tone
Controls

A Yamaha 'first, these tone controls use a
combination of negative feedback (NFB) and capa-
citor-resistor (CR) elements, giving smooth and
accurate control of tonal quality, and a flat res-
ponse in the zero position, with extremely low
noise level (-100 dB) and correspondingly low
distortion.

4. Comprehensive Operating Controls and Func-
tions

With the CA-44 you can listen to any one
source while recording another, or while copying
one tape recording onto a second deck. Also you
can use the Rec Out Off position to disconnect the
CA-44 from your tape recorder when not actual-
ly recording.

5. Precise Continuous Volume Control and Full

Loudness Compensation

The volume control is an extremely precise,
continuous type, accurately in balance within :1
dB from maximum down to -70 dB. For listening
at low volumes, there is a Loudness Switch which
gives greatly increased naturalness of reproduction,
compensating for our ears reduced sensitivity to
high and low frequencies.
